Development Permitting
Development Permitting is responsible for administering the City of Grande Prairie’s Land Use Bylaw. The co-ordination and review of all development applications and proposals to ensure compliance with the Land Use Bylaw achieves this.
Enforcement of the City of Grande Prairie Land Use Bylaw
As part of administering the City of Grande Prairie's Land Use Bylaw, Development Permitting enforces bylaw infractions, and acts on development related concerns/complaints from the general public.

Our Team
Under the Director of Public Works and the Development Coordinator, who head the department and its staff we consist of:
Development Officers: As Development Authorities, who are appointed to exercise development powers and duties on behalf of the City of Grande Prairie, they are responsible for reviewing and deciding on all major/minor development applications. They are also responsible for compliance of the land use bylaw through Education and Enforcement
Development Services Assistants: Assist the department with the development permit process as well as fullfilling some of the duties of the Development Officers.

Outside Approving Development Authority
The Public Works Committe is the approving authority for any application for a discretionary use, certain variances, or any application refered to them by a Development Officer.
Public Works Committee (PWC):
The Public Works Committee deals with policy matters and programs about the property and physical assets of the City, and has responsibility for the following functions; Building Inspections (Gas, Electric and Plumbing), Development, Drainage, Engineering, Land Use Planning, Parks Construction and Maintenance, Recycling and Waste Reduction, Roads and Sidewalks, Sanitary Sewage Collection and Treatment, Solid Waste, Collection and Disposal, Traffic Control, Transit, Utility Lots, Vehicles and Equipment and Water Treatment and Distribution, and any other matters referred to it by Council.

Subdivision and Development Appeal Board (SDAB)
Any decision made by the Development Authority (Development Officer, PWC) on a development permit application can be appealed. The Subdivision and Development Appeal Board (SDAB) rules on any
development related appeals.
